Plan it out
Split into two groups in class - one group will be Manchester United and the other group will represent AC Milan.
Your teacher will appoint a person in each group to be the manager and will also tell you what team you are.
Anyone not playing should make notes to write a match report or film the match so that it can be replayed and worked upon.
Work together on a match plan. Come up with five tactics you will use.
After some warm-ups embark on a match against eachother. At half-time make sure you swap in any subs so that everyone has a go at playing.
When the game has ended reveal your tactics to the other side - did they work? Would you use them again? Did they cause any problems?
If you videoed the match watch some of it and see if you can identify the tactics being used - each manager should be able to point them out!
